    Common Problems and Things to Watch Out For in the 2010 Lexus IS 250 F Sport

    Okay, let's talk about the not-so-glamorous side: potential issues. While the 2010 Lexus IS 250 F Sport is generally known for its reliability, like any used car, it can have its share of problems. One common issue to watch out for is carbon buildup in the engine, which can affect performance and fuel efficiency. It’s essential to make sure the car has been properly maintained, and if you are interested in buying one, it’s always a good idea to get a pre-purchase inspection from a trusted mechanic. Other potential issues might include water pump failure, oil leaks, and problems with the infotainment system.

    Here's a deeper dive into the common problems: Carbon buildup in the engine is a common issue in direct-injection engines. It can lead to decreased power, rough idling, and reduced fuel economy. Regular maintenance, including using high-quality fuel and performing engine cleanings, can help mitigate this issue. Water pump failure is another potential problem. If the water pump fails, it can lead to overheating and engine damage. Symptoms of a failing water pump include coolant leaks and unusual noises. Oil leaks can occur over time, particularly from the valve cover gaskets and oil pan. Regular inspections and timely repairs are crucial to prevent more serious damage. The infotainment system, while functional, can sometimes experience glitches or malfunctions. Check for any issues with the touchscreen, navigation, or Bluetooth connectivity during a test drive. In addition to these issues, it is always a good idea to pay attention to the car’s overall condition. Check for any signs of accidents, rust, or other damage. Make sure to check the car’s service history to see if it has been properly maintained.
